Robert M. Pope

January 30, 1923 — January 31, 2017

Robert M. Pope, 94, of Elizabethtown, passed away Tuesday at the Masonic Home, Elizabethtown.

Born in Kingston, Jan. 30, 1923, he was a son of the late Archibald and Sara Evans Pope.

He was the widower of Eleanor M. Staller Pope, who passed away in 2015.

He served in the Army Air Corps in World War II.

A graduate of Kingston High School, Class of 1941, he was formerly employed by Aetna Steel; Miller, Whitby and Steidle Architect, Tamaqua; William Major, Architect and Engineers, Bristol.

He was a 50-year member of First United Methodist Church, Pottsville.

In addition to his wife, he was preceded in death by a daughter, Kathleen Pope, who passed away in 2016.

Robert is survived by two sons, the Rev. Robert A. Pope, husband of Rola, Myerstown, and David R. Pope, Gilbertsville; grandchildren, Eric R. Pope, Bryan M. (Lindsay) Pope and Margaret L. Pope; two great-grandchildren, Carly and Alexander Pope; a sister, Margaret Jones, Forte Fort.

A Celebration of Life funeral service will be held at 11 a.m. Monday at First United Methodist Church, Pottsville, with the Rev. John Wallace officiating. A viewing for family and friends will be held Monday prior to the service beginning at 10 a.m. at the church. Interment will take place in Schuylkill Memorial Park, Schuylkill Haven. The family request donations to First United Methodist Church, 330 W. Market St., Pottsville, PA 17901.
